Description

Marianne Forman sets this metaphorical text for choir, piano, and optional oboe: "...My soul is carried to the shore on breath divine, and on its helm there rests a hand other than mine: One who was known in storms to sail...above the roaring of the gale I hear my Lord." Safe to the Land is both deeply comforting and profoundly moving.

Poetic Lyrics

I know not if dark or bright shall be my lot;
if that wherein my hopes delight be best or not.
It may be mine to drag for years toil’s heavy chain,
or day and night my portion tears on bed of pain.

My soul is carried to the shore on breath divine,
and on its helm there rests a hand other than mine.
One who was known in storms to sail I have on board;
above the roaring of the gale, I hear my Lord.

He holds me when the billows smite, I shall not fall!
Though sorrows rise, yet mercies flow, He tempers all.
Safe to the land, safe to the land, the end is this,
and then with Him go hand in hand far into bliss.
